logo

Output a59bfb302beffc5087c34259bbe30669664952567f6b4ede56d19a2d57a10b7e:1

value
5264848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2143b05ec32455fdf76076ff6b22fdc503667043 OP_EQUAL
address
34iuJz4Mq9FpNZgdUG1UZP9Hn4V4gC5jwm
transaction
a59bfb302beffc5087c34259bbe30669664952567f6b4ede56d19a2d57a10b7e